Standard delivery usually takes about 5 days, while expedited options can reduce this to 4 days, depending on the moving company and route conditions.
Choosing a smaller shipment size, flexible moving dates, and self-packing can help reduce costs. Comparing quotes from multiple long distance movers is recommended.
Booking at least 4 to 6 weeks in advance is advisable to secure better rates and availability, especially during peak moving seasons.
Yes, moving companies operating between states must be licensed by the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A) to ensure compliance and protection.
Plan for long transit times, coordinate packing and unpacking schedules, and consider storage options if needed. Weather and traffic can also impact delivery timing.
